Supplementary Figure 8: Neural responses to light ramp stimulation
From: Tactile frequency discrimination is enhanced by circumventing neocortical adaptation

a, Normalized PSTHs in response to different stimulus types. PSTHs were constructed after combining spike data from all recorded neurons into one dataset, thus showing differences in response behavior over the whole neural population. b, Normalized population PSTHs for 20-Hz (left panel) and 40-Hz (right panel) light ramp stimulation. Shown are the first and last 100 ms of the stimulus sequence. c, Normalized SR per light ramp stimulation at different repetition frequencies over all recorded neurons. Dashed lines show AI levels.
